About this course

ESP32 + Databases to Control Anything Anywhere: Step by Step Course to help you create your first internet-connected electronics projects using ESP32 wifi breakout board. <<<


Welcome to this course.


The course lesson will explain “How to control stuff from all around the world” by using Arduino IDE Programming Environment. This course will work best for you if you have basic knowledge of Electronics and Arduino. You could connect sensors to an Arduino and send the values to a database on the internet. Then you could enter a website that you will create in this course to see the values from anywhere in the world with an internet connection. You are no longer stuck controlling your devices locally.


You could also add boolean buttons to your website and control stuff connected to the Arduino such as Motors, LEDs, Relays, and more.
